数据库主要划分为哪四种类型

数据库主要划分为哪四种类型

扫码添加渲大师小管家,免费领取渲染插件、素材、模型、教程合集大礼包!

数据库主要划分为哪四种类型

数据库是现代信息管理和数据处理的重要工具,根据其不同的特点和应用领域,可以将数据库主要划分为关系型数据库、面向对象数据库、层次型数据库和网络型数据库四种类型。

关系型数据库是最常见也是最广泛使用的一种类型。它采用表格形式来组织数据,并通过行和列的方式存储数据。每个表格都有一个唯一标识符称为主键,用于区分不同记录。关系型数据库使用结构化查询语言(SQL)进行操作和管理,具有良好的可扩展性、可靠性和安全性。例如MySQL、Oracle等都属于关系型数据库。

数据库主要划分为哪四种类型

面向对象数据库以对象作为基本单位来组织数据。它将现实世界中的实体抽象成对象,并通过类之间定义的关联来描述它们之间的联系。面向对象数据库支持封装、继承和多态等特性,在处理复杂数据结构时更加灵活高效。面向对象模型与编程语言紧密结合,在开发过程中能够提供更好地支持与集成。

第三种类型是层次型数据库,在这种模式下,数据被组织成树状结构,并且只允许父节点指向子节点而不允许子节点指向父节点。层次型数据库适用于具有明确的父子关系的数据,例如组织结构、文件系统等。尽管层次型数据库在某些特定场景下具有优势,但由于其固定的树状结构限制了数据之间的灵活性和扩展性,在实际应用中使用较少。

数据库主要划分为哪四种类型

最后一种类型是网络型数据库,它是在层次型数据库基础上进行改进而来。网络型数据库允许任意节点之间建立联系,并且一个节点可以同时作为多个节点的子节点或父节点。这种模式下,数据之间可以更加灵活地建立复杂关系,并且支持多对多关联。由于网络型数据库需要维护大量指针和链接信息,导致操作复杂度增加。

总体而言,在选择合适的数据库类型时需要根据具体需求来进行评估和选择。不同类型的数据库各自有其优缺点,在不同场景下能够提供更好地支持与解决方案。无论是关系型、面向对象、层次型还是网络型数据库都在不同程度上推动了信息管理与处理技术的发展,并为我们提供了强大而高效地数据存储与查询工具。

数据库主要划分为哪四种类型的表

数据库是计算机科学中非常重要的概念,它用于存储和管理大量数据。在数据库中,表是其中最基本的组成部分之一。根据表的不同特点和功能,可以将数据库主要划分为以下四种类型的表。

第一种类型是关系型表。关系型表使用了关系模型来组织数据,并且具有固定的列和行结构。每个列都有一个特定的数据类型,并且每个行代表一个实体或记录。这种类型的表非常适合处理结构化数据,例如用户信息、订单记录等等。关系型数据库管理系统(RDBMS)如MySQL、Oracle等都支持关系型表。

第二种类型是层次型表。层次型表以树状结构来组织数据,其中每个节点可以包含多个子节点,但只能有一个父节点(除了根节点)。这种类型的表适合表示具有明确层级关系的数据集合,例如公司组织架构、文件目录结构等等。

第三种类型是网络型表。网络型模式扩展了层次模式,在此模式下允许任意两个实体之间建立多对多(M:N)连接关系,并通过指针链接进行导航操作。这使得网络模式更加灵活和强大,在处理复杂互联网环境下非常有效。

最后一种类型是面向对象表。面向对象表是在关系型模型的基础上引入了面向对象的概念,将数据组织为类和对象的集合。每个类对应一个表,而每个实例则对应一个记录。这种类型的表适用于处理复杂的数据结构和关联性较强的数据。

数据库主要划分为关系型、层次型、网络型和面向对象四种类型的表。不同类型适用于不同场景下存储和管理数据,并且各自具有特定优势和功能。了解这些不同类型可以帮助我们更好地选择合适的数据库模式来满足需求,并提高数据处理效率和灵活性。

数据库主要划分为哪四种类型的

数据库是计算机科学中非常重要的概念,它用于存储和管理大量数据。根据其结构和功能,数据库可以主要划分为关系型数据库、面向对象数据库、层次型数据库和网络型数据库四种类型。

关系型数据库是最常见也是最广泛使用的一种类型。它以表格的形式组织数据,并通过行和列来表示实体之间的关系。关系型数据库使用结构化查询语言(SQL)进行操作和查询数据。这种类型的优点在于具有良好的可扩展性、易于维护以及丰富而强大的查询功能。

面向对象数据库则更加注重对对象之间关联性建模与处理。它将实体视为独立个体,并将属性与方法封装在一起作为一个整体进行处理。面向对象数据库适用于需要处理复杂数据结构或需要高度灵活性和可扩展性的应用程序开发。

第三种类型是层次型数据库,它采用了树状结构来组织数据。每个节点都可以包含多个子节点,但只能有一个父节点。这种模式适合描述具有明确层级关系或树形结构特征的数据集合,例如文件系统或组织架构等。

最后一种类型是网络型数据库,它采用了图状结构来组织数据。不同于层次型数据库中的单一父节点,网络型数据库允许一个节点拥有多个父节点。这种模式适合描述具有复杂关系和交叉引用的数据集合,例如社交网络或知识图谱等。

根据其结构和功能特点,数据库可以主要划分为关系型、面向对象、层次型和网络型四种类型。每种类型都在不同场景下发挥着重要作用,并且随着技术的发展与应用需求的变化,各类数据库也在不断演进与创新。

分享到 :
相关推荐

数据库调优的方式(tomcat优化的几种方法)

1、数据库调优的方式数据库调优是提高数据库性能和效率的关键步骤。通过对数据库结构、[...

thymeleaf有必要学吗(thymeleaf和vue能一起用吗)

1、thymeleaf有必要学吗"thymeleaf有必要学吗"这个问题涉及到了[&...

显示器刷新率怎么调(苹果手机的屏幕刷新率在哪设置)

大家好,今天来介绍显示器刷新率怎么调的问题,以下是渲大师小编对此问题的归纳和整理,感...

根服务器长什么样(自己搭建一个服务器多少钱)

1、根服务器长什么样根服务器是互联网体系结构中最重要的组件之一,它被视为互联网的命[...

发表评论

您的电子邮箱地址不会被公开。 必填项已用*标注